U0069 is a network communication code indicating that the vehicle's communication bus 'E' (a specific CAN or LIN network channel) has lost communication, essentially meaning the circuit is 'open' or a module on that bus is not responding. This is not a driveability code but indicates a wiring, connector, or module failure on a secondary vehicle network.
The control module connected to Bus E has failed internally and no longer transmits or receives data, breaking the network communication.
The communication wires for Bus E are broken, cut, chafed, or disconnected, creating an open circuit condition.
Water intrusion, oxidation, or physical damage to the module's connector pins prevents reliable electrical connection.
The module is not receiving proper battery or ignition power, so it cannot participate in network communication.
A corroded, loose, or damaged ground wire to the module prevents it from functioning on the network.
Extremely rare - the main vehicle computer managing Bus E has failed; almost never the cause compared to other possibilities.
No. The PCM/ECM is almost never the cause of U0069. This code almost always results from a failed module on that specific bus, wiring issues, or connector problems. Technicians sometimes replace the PCM unnecessarily when the actual fix is much simpler (repairing a wire, replacing a sensor module, or fixing a connector).
It depends on which module is affected. If it's a non-essential module like a radio or climate control, the vehicle may drive normally but with reduced functionality. If it affects critical modules like the ABS or body control, safety features or starting may be impacted. Have it diagnosed promptly.
